Driv3r comes to PC in March  by Craig D at 14:07

PC
Atari have announced that the PC version of Driv3r will hit the shelves in March and to celebrate released a batch of new screenshots.

It sould seem the PC version get's a whole new level and a making of movie.

Apparantly the game also features the voices of Michael Madsen, Ving Rhames, Mickey Rourke and Michelle Rodriguez. The movie fans amongst us will know most if not all of those names.

Let's hope the PC version is more polished than the poorly received console version.

TAKING IT TO THE NEXT LEVEL
Following the massively successful console version, Driv3r for the personal computer features an all new level exclusive to the PC release. The level is set between 'Gators Yacht' and 'Trapped' and is called 'The Hit'. It features an assassination attempt on Tanner and a tense, hot pursuit which makes the most of Miami's waterfront location and the variety of vehicles it calls for. The PC version will also see additions in other areas including for the first time the full 12 minute long DRIV3R 'making of' movie.
